Back to Humors of Ballinaraheen
HUMOURS OF BALLINARAHEEN. Irish, Jig. E Minor. Standard tuning (fiddle). AABB. The second strain is shared with the tunes "Humors of Winnington (The)," and with the "Bottle of Punch" family of tunes.
Source for notated version: "Patrick MacDowell, the distinguished sculptor" (1799-1870) {Joyce}.
Printed sources: Joyce (Old Irish Folk Music and Songs), 1909; No. 520, p. 281.
